The first U.S. stamped enveloped was issued in 1853

  • First commemorative stamped enveloped in 1876 to celebrate the Philadelphia Centennial Exposition
  • Austria issued the first postal card in 1869
  • Bavaria issued the first reply card – two postal cards joined together, one for the original message and the second for reply

An aerogramme is a letter sheet with gummed flaps, imprinted with an indicium, and issued for air mail use. They became popular following World War II, but got their start in 1870 France as a method to get mail out of Paris by balloon during the Franco-Prussian War.
